Liss to Chorley by train

Planning a train journey from Liss to Chorley? The trip usually takes about 5hrs 13 mins, covering approximately 194 miles (313 kilometres). With roughly 17 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£49.10,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Liss to Chorley start from as little as £49.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Liss to Chorley start from £97.40 one way, or £139.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Liss to Chorley are available for £100.50 one way, or £201.00 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Liss train station provides essential facilities to ensure that your travel is smooth and comfortable. Open Monday to Saturday, the ticket office is ready to help from early morning until noon. However, if you're travelling on a Sunday or outside of these hours, don't worry. You'll find ticket machines at the station capable of issuing tickets purchased online and available with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

Whether you're an experienced traveler or new to the UK rail system, Liss Station offers an induction loop for those who may need it, and smartcard validators are ready for your use. While staff support is limited, customer help points make navigating this charming yet modest station easier. Safety is assured with CCTV monitoring throughout the premises. For those relying on public facilities, restrooms are available inside the booking hall but coincide with ticket office hours.

Transport Links and Accessibility

If Liss is just a stop on your journey, you can easily continue your adventure with the station's rail replacement services found on the station forecourt. Check out their bus links too—and if you'd like to plan your on-ground travels, there's detailed information readily available here. For accessibility, Liss offers step-free access to its platforms, making it user-friendly for those with mobility aids. Transverse the station via a handy ramp or level crossing, although only Platform 1 (going toward London) has complete step-free access via a ramp.

Biking and Parking in Liss

For cyclists, Liss station offers convenience with sheltered bicycle storage racks on Platform 2. It prioritizes both accessibility and security, with CCTV ensuring peace of mind while you travel. Car travelers will find ample parking space, with dedicated spots for accessible parking even though car park equipment isn't available.

Facilities and Accessibility at Chorley Station

Chorley Station ensures a seamless ticketing experience with its easily accessible ticket office and machines. The ticket office operates from 06:25 to early evenings on weekdays and extends later into the evening on Saturdays, ensuring ample time for ticket purchases. For those who prefer digital convenience, smartcards are issued at the station, accompanied by validators for a swift and hassle-free check-in.

Your safety and comfort are paramount, with the station being equipped with CCTV. Although there are no waiting areas or first-class lounges, seating is available for your convenience. It's worth noting that while the station is fully equipped with steps and ramps for step-free access, it does fall short in terms of some accessible facilities such as accessible toilets and waiting rooms.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Chorley Station is fantastically connected to various transport modes. If your journey involves buses, the nearby bus interchange on Shepherd’s Way caters to connections for routes towards Bolton and Preston.
